Problems solved by technology

[0003] In the traditional high-voltage switchgear, the anti-misoperation of the isolating switch and the conjoined vacuum circuit breaker generally adopts a movable program lock. The selective insertion and cooperation of multiple holes and pins is also easy to get stuck and unreliable; also because the movable parts sometimes shift, causing it to get stuck, etc., which makes it inconvenient to use
The existing bypass high-voltage cabinet circuit breaker is fixed and difficult to replace, and the busbar is not closed and easy to touch the live parts, etc., which have obvious structural defects. In order to improve the reliability and continuity of power supply, in order to improve the unfavorable factors such as the fixed installation of the circuit breaker of the original bypass high-voltage cabinet, which is not easy to replace, and the busbar is not closed and easy to touch the live parts, etc., in recent years, the high-voltage switch cabinet with bypass central cabinet has an anti-malfunction operation system. In order to meet the market demand, its "five-proof" interlocking mechanism has been continuously improved. Although it overcomes some disadvantages of the original high-voltage cabinet, the five-proof interlocking mechanism in the more scientific and reasonable high-voltage switchgear anti-malfunction operating system Institutions still need to improve the design

Abstract

The invention discloses a five-prevention interlocking device in a bypass centrally-arranged cabinet. The five-prevention interlocking device has a mechanical interlocking function and an electrical auxiliary interlocking function. When an outgoing cabinet circuit breaker needs maintenance or fails and requires bypass power supplying, at first charging test is performed on a bypass bus; a bypass cabinet circuit breaker is disconnected; when a bypass circuit breaker is switched off, and a requirement for the electrification of an electromagnetic lock of a bypass isolation switch when an earthing switch is in a separation position is satisfied, the electromagnetic lock is switched on, and the switch-on operation is performed on the bypass isolation switch; and after the switch-on operation of the bypass isolation switch is finished, switch-on operation is performed on the bypass switch cabinet circuit breaker; an outgoing cabinet and a bypass cabinet simultaneously supply power for an outgoing load loop; and finally, switch-off operation is performed on the outgoing cabinet circuit breaker, and the outgoing cabinet circuit breaker is pulled to a test position, and the bypass cabinet and a bypass isolation switch loop can continuously supply power for an outgoing load. With the five-prevention interlocking device in the bypass centrally-arranged cabinet of the invention adopted, uninterrupted power supplying can be realized; the isolation switch, the circuit breakers, the earthing switch can be in interactive interlocking with each other, which enables safety and stable operation; no sequence errors occur in an operation process; and a requirement for five-prevention can be realized.

Description

technical field [0001] The invention relates to the field of complete sets of electrical switchgear technical equipment, in particular to a five-proof interlocking device with a bypass central cabinet in a high-voltage switchgear anti-misoperation operating system. Background technique [0002] In high-voltage complete sets of electrical equipment, in order to ensure the reliable operation of metal-enclosed switchgear and the personal safety of operators, the central cabinet with bypass in the high-voltage cabinet is mainly composed of vacuum circuit breakers, disconnectors, grounding switches and other operating elements, as well as mutual inductance. Devices and other measuring and protection components form a power supply circuit.
